Núcleo IA & GP

Voluntary inter-chapter PMI® Brazil research initiative on AI ⨯ Project Management

Anchored by an open-source platform that binds the management framework, documents and structures the procedural and information flow, and gamifies the volunteer journey — where AI is both research subject and operational substrate. Designed so any PMI chapter globally can adopt the operational model.

Problem

01.

PMI Brazilian chapters had distributed appetite for AI ⨯ Project Management research but no shared operational substrate to coordinate volunteer work, capture knowledge, or track contributions across chapters. Volunteer-run initiatives typically fragment across spreadsheets, WhatsApp groups, and ad-hoc Google Drives — losing both signal and momentum.

Approach

02.

Open-source multi-tenant platform with governance chains, LGPD-by-design, trilingual UX (EN · PT · ES), and an MCP-based AI integration layer wired to the external tools volunteers already use (Drive · GitHub · Canva · Credly · PMI VEP · Calendar · WhatsApp). Co-founded 2024 as a PMI Goiás pilot; structured as a federated alliance from the outset so any chapter can adopt the operational model. The open-source platform and the management framework are authored and documented by Vitor; the voluntary initiative itself is collectively founded and led. AI as both research subject and operational substrate — not just a topic studied, but the engine that runs the org.

Impact

03.

50+ volunteers across federated Brazilian chapters (PMI-GO · PMI-CE · PMI-DF · PMI-MG · PMI-RS) organized in research streams and operational workgroups. Inter-institutional collaborations welcome. Platform: 32 Cloudflare Edge Functions, 266 MCP tools, 4,000+ i18n keys across 3 locales, 1,418+ tests passing, $0/month infrastructure.
